''Austrocidaria prionota'' is a species of moth in the family Geometridae. It is endemic to New Zealand. It is found in the South Island and is regarded as being uncommon. Taxonomy This species was first described by Edward Meyrick in 1883 using specimens collected at Castle Hill and Dunedin and given the name ''Arsinoe prionota''. Meyrick described the species in more detail in 1884. In 1886 Meyrick recognised that the genus name he had used for this species had been used previously and renamed the genus in which he placed this species as ''Anachloris''. In 1917 Meyrick synonymised ''Anachloris'' with ''Hydriomena''. George Hudson described and illustrated the species both in his 1898 book ''New Zealand Moths and Butterflies (Macro-lepidoptera)'' and in his 1928 book ''The Butterflies and Moths of New Zealand'' using the name ''Hydriomena prionota''. Dunedin ( ; mi, Ōtepoti) is the second-largest city in the South Island of New Zealand (after Christchurch), and the principal city of the Otago region. Its name comes from , the Scottish Gaelic name for Edinburgh, the capital of Scotland. The city has a rich Scottish, Chinese and Māori heritage. With an estimated population of as of , Dunedin is both New Zealand's seventh-most populous metro and urban area. For historic, cultural and geographic reasons the city has long been considered one of New Zealand's four main centres. The urban area of Dunedin lies on the central-eastern coast of Otago, surrounding the head of Otago Harbour, and the harbour and hills around Dunedin are the remnants of an extinct volcano. The city suburbs extend out into the surrounding valleys and hills, onto the isthmus of the Otago Peninsula, and along the shores of the Otago Harbour and the Pacific Ocean. ''Coprosma'' is a genus of flowering plants in the family Rubiaceae. It is found in New Zealand, Hawaiian Islands, Borneo, Java, New Guinea, islands of the Pacific Ocean to Australia and the Juan Fernández Islands. Description The name ''Coprosma'' means "smelling like dung" and refers to the smell (methanethiol) given out by the crushed leaves of a few species. Many species are small shrubs with tiny evergreen leaves, but a few are small trees and have much larger leaves. The flowers have insignificant petals and are wind-pollinated, with long anthers and stigmas. Most species are dioecious, but some (particularly those native to New Zealand) species can sometimes have individuals with perfect flowers. Natural hybrids are common. The fruit is a non-poisonous juicy berry, most often bright orange (but can be dark red or even light blue), containing two small seeds. ''Myrsine divaricata'' known as weeping māpou or weeping matipo, is a small tree up to tall or often a shrub. It has a strongly divaricating habit with interlaced branched. The woody parts are stiff and pubescent when young. The small leathery simple leaves are borne on short petioles and may be slightly two lobed at the end. The very small yellow or reddish flowers may be borne singly or in small groups which mature into small purple, occasionally white, fruit. References

Kahurangi National Park in the northwest of the South Island of New Zealand is the second largest of the thirteen national parks of New Zealand. It was gazetted in 1996 and covers , ranging to near Golden Bay in the north. Much of what was the North-west Nelson Forest Park formed the basis of the new park. Kahurangi Point, regarded as the boundary between the West Coast and Tasman Regions, is located in the park, as is Mount Owen. The main tramping tracks in the park are the Heaphy Track and the Wangapeka Track. The park is administered by the Department of Conservation. Tramping, rafting and caving are popular activities in the park. After being prohibited for several years, mountainbiking was allowed on the Heaphy Track on a trial basis for the winters of 2011, 2012 and 2013. The effect of the cyclists on trampers and the wildlife were to determine whether the trial continued or not. The Canterbury Museum is a museum located in the central city of Christchurch, New Zealand, in the city's Cultural Precinct. The museum was established in 1867 with Julius von Haast – whose collection formed its core – as its first director. The building is registered as a "Historic Place – Category I" by Heritage New Zealand. Directors The title curator and director has been used interchangeably during the history of Canterbury Museum. Von Haast was the museum's inaugural director; Haast died in 1887. Following Haast's death, Frederick Hutton was acting director until Henry Ogg Forbes took on a permanent position in December 1888 upon his return from England. In August 1892, Forbes permanently moved to England, and Hutton was appointed full director from May 1892 until October 1905. ''Austrocidaria lithurga'' is a species of moth in the family Geometridae. It is endemic to New Zealand. This moth is classified as ''at risk, naturally uncommon'' by the Department of Conservation. Taxonomy This species was first described by Edward Meyrick in 1911 and named ''Hydriomena lithurga''. Meyrick used a specimen obtained from R. M. Sunley who had collected a pupa from a '' Muehlenbeckia'' plant at Mākara Beach, Wellington, in November and had raised the adult in captivity. George Hudson described and illustrated the species in his 1928 book ''The Butterflies and Moths of New Zealand''. In 1971 John S. Dugdale assigned ''H. lithurga'' to the genus ''Austrocidaria''. Dugdale postulated that ''A. lithurga'' might prove synonymous with ''Austrocidaria prionota''. The holotype specimen is held at the Natural History Museum, London. George Vernon Hudson FRSNZ (20 April 1867 – 5 April 1946) was a British-born New Zealand entomologist credited with proposing the modern daylight saving time. He was awarded the Hector Memorial Medal in 1923. Biography Born in London, Britain, on Easter Saturday, 1867 Hudson was the sixth child of Emily Jane Carnal and Charles Hudson, an artist and stained-glass window designer. By the age of 14 he had built up a collection of British insects, and had published a paper in '' The Entomologist''. In 1881 Hudson moved with his father to Nelson, New Zealand. He worked on a farm, and in 1883, aged 16, he began working at the post office in Wellington, where he eventually became chief clerk, retiring in 1918. Hudson was a member of the 1907 Sub-Antarctic Islands Scientific Expedition. Its main aim was to extend the magnetic survey of New Zealand by investigating the Auckland and Campbell islands but botanical, biological, and zoological surveys were also conducted.
